How Life Works Here
Ingrams Way is located in Wealden, near Hailsham, East Sussex. Crime levels are below the local average (56 incidents in 12 months).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. The nearest transport stop is 204m away (bus). Rail links may require a connecting journey. The median property price is £313,250, with strong growth of 22% over five years. Based on 38 transactions recorded since 2014. The market is highly active with frequent sales. The area has a notable retired population. There are 3 schools within 2 km.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. The nearest school is just 83m away. This street may particularly suit property investors. Market indicators suggest an upward trend. Overall, this street scores 53 out of 100 for liveability, above the district average.
